tools/nolibc: x86_64: shrink _start with _start_c

move most of the _start operations to _start_c(), include the
stackprotector initialization.

void __attribute__((weak, noreturn, optimize("Os", "omit-frame-pointer"))) __no_stack_protector _start(void)
{
__asm__ volatile (
#ifdef _NOLIBC_STACKPROTECTOR
"call __stack_chk_init\n" /* initialize stack protector */
#endif
"pop %rdi\n" /* argc (first arg, %rdi) */
"mov %rsp, %rsi\n" /* argv[] (second arg, %rsi) */
"lea 8(%rsi,%rdi,8),%rdx\n" /* then a NULL then envp (third arg, %rdx) */
"mov %rdx, environ\n" /* save environ */
"xor %ebp, %ebp\n" /* zero the stack frame */
"mov %rdx, %rax\n" /* search for auxv (follows NULL after last env) */
"0:\n"
"add $8, %rax\n" /* search for auxv using rax, it follows the */
"cmp -8(%rax), %rbp\n" /* ... NULL after last env (rbp is zero here) */
"jnz 0b\n"
"mov %rax, _auxv\n" /* save it into _auxv */
"and $-16, %rsp\n" /* x86 ABI : esp must be 16-byte aligned before call */
"call main\n" /* main() returns the status code, we'll exit with it. */
"mov %eax, %edi\n" /* retrieve exit code (32 bit) */
"mov $60, %eax\n" /* NR_exit == 60 */
"syscall\n" /* really exit */
"hlt\n" /* ensure it does not return */
"xor %ebp, %ebp\n" /* zero the stack frame */
"mov %rsp, %rdi\n" /* save stack pointer to %rdi, as arg1 of _start_c */
"and $-16, %rsp\n" /* %rsp must be 16-byte aligned before call */
"call _start_c\n" /* transfer to c runtime */
"hlt\n" /* ensure it does not return */
);
__builtin_unreachable();
}
